KerberRose is seeking an Administrative Assistant to provide support for our Oshkosh office.  Under the direct supervision of the Partner in Charge, responsibilities include typing, filing, and scheduling; maintaining financial records; serving as the initial point of contact for client inquiries and payments; coordinating meetings and conferences; managing supplies and direct mailings; and assisting with special projects. This position will require 35 to 40 hours a week running from January 1 through April 15, and 15 to 20 hours a week the remainder of the year.


Responsibilities:

• Organizes and prioritizes large volumes of calls, information, and mail; drafts written responses and replies by phone or email as needed, and responds to routine requests for information.

• Greet clients professionally, ensuring they feel welcomed and attended to promptly.

• Handles confidential information related to client tax returns with discretion and professionalism.

• Scans, organizes, and maintains electronic copies of tax documents.

• Answers and directs incoming phone calls, takes messages, and handles both routine and non-routine inquiries.

• Prepares, types, and formats business documents including correspondence, memos, charts, tables, graphs, business plans, financial statements, and assembled/e-filed tax returns.

• Proofreads documents for spelling, grammar, and layout to ensure accuracy, clarity, and professionalism in all final materials.

• Works independently and collaboratively on ongoing and special projects; serves as project manager when requested by the Partner in Charge, coordinating presentations, direct mailings, and information distribution.

• Maintains organized client files, monitors and tracks office projects and tax returns, and oversees supply ordering.

• Supports office operations by processing petty cash, submitting accounts payable to the home office, preparing client billing, and recording meeting minutes.

• Ensures the professional appearance of the office, including upkeep of the lobby and common areas.


Requirements

• Associate’s degree or equivalent experience.

• May be required to work occasional Saturdays during peak tax season.

•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.

• Ability to plan, prioritize, and manage a varied workload.

• Excellent customer service skills with the ability to deliver a premier client experience.
